CHARMING INDEPENDENT STUDIO OF THE MARAIS
Nomadomia Rating: 3.3 stars
- This apartment is ideal for solo travelers or couples who want to be in the heart of Le Marais.
- Guests should be aware of the apartment's compact size and potential issues with cleanliness and maintenance.
- Jacques is a friendly and responsive host who will do his best to ensure a comfortable stay.
- The apartment's location is its strongest selling point, with plenty of amenities and attractions within walking distance.
- Guests should carefully review the apartment's photos and description to ensure it meets their needs and expectations.
Good points:
- Excellent location in the heart of Le Marais, close to shops, restaurants, cafes, and metro stations.
- Jacques is a friendly, welcoming, and responsive host who goes out of his way to ensure a comfortable stay.
- The apartment is quiet, despite being in a lively area, and has a charming patio.
- The studio is well-equipped with essentials, including a washing machine, microwave, and espresso machine.
- Jacques is accommodating and flexible with check-in and check-out times.
Bad points:
- The apartment is very small, which can be a challenge for more than two people.
- The loft bed has a low ceiling, which can be claustrophobic for some guests.
- The bathroom could be cleaner, and some guests have reported issues with mold and mildew.
- The kitchen is compact and lacks some essential utensils and equipment.
- The apartment can be noisy, especially when the school nearby is in session.
Time trend:
- Over the years, guests have consistently praised Jacques' hospitality and the apartment's location.
- However, there have been ongoing issues with the apartment's cleanliness and maintenance, particularly in the bathroom.
- Some guests have reported that the apartment is showing signs of wear and tear, with issues like low water pressure and non-functional lights.
- Despite these issues, Jacques has continued to be a responsive and accommodating host.
